I want any wr mems or telnet Logons to be logged to my SysLog server from my Cisco 877 and 1841 routers, is this possible?
10-14-2007 03:12 PM
Andy
It is possible to send records to AAA accounting for level 15 commands. So if you are using AAA you could use the accounting facility to get write mem etc. I am not aware of any way to just send these to syslog.
There is a way to send telnet logins to syslog. It is a pretty new feature so you need to be running recent code to be able to do it. This link discusses the enhancements to login including the ability to send messages to syslog for successful login or for not successful login:

Hi Whiteford,
you can send logins attempted messages to syslog server by enabling the following command
"login on-success log [every login ]"
There is another command to track failed login attempts
" login on-failure log"
This feature is available for ios 12.3(4)T and above
